/*
Theme Name: YT
Theme URI: https://sfl-tl.com
Author: YT Team
Description: A professional B2B telecommunications equipment WordPress theme inspired by txo.com and revodistribution.com
Version: 1.0.0
Requires at least: 6.0
Tested up to: 6.7
Requires PHP: 7.4
License: GNU General Public License v2 or later
License URI: http://www.gnu.org/licenses/gpl-2.0.html
Text Domain: yt
Tags: one-column, two-columns, custom-menu, featured-images, full-width-template, theme-options
*/

:root {
	--color-primary: #0A1F2E;
	--color-secondary: #00A651;
	--color-accent: #FF6B35;
	--color-white: #FFFFFF;
	--color-light: #F5F5F5;
	--color-gray: #666666;
	--color-dark: #333333;
	--color-navy: #0D2B3E;

	--font-primary: 'Inter', system-ui, -apple-system, sans-serif;
	--font-size-h1: 3rem;
	--font-size-h2: 2.25rem;
	--font-size-h3: 1.75rem;
	--font-size-h4: 1.25rem;
	--font-size-body: 1rem;
	--font-size-small: 0.875rem;
	--font-weight-regular: 400;
	--font-weight-semibold: 600;
	--font-weight-bold: 700;

	--spacing-xs: 4px;
	--spacing-sm: 8px;
	--spacing-md: 16px;
	--spacing-lg: 24px;
	--spacing-xl: 40px;
	--spacing-xxl: 80px;

	--breakpoint-sm: 576px;
	--breakpoint-md: 768px;
	--breakpoint-lg: 992px;
	--breakpoint-xl: 1200px;
	--breakpoint-xxl: 1440px;

	--transition-fast: 0.15s ease;
	--transition-base: 0.3s ease;
	--transition-slow: 0.5s ease;

	--container-max: 1320px;
	--container-wide: 1440px;

	--color-primary-light: #132D4A;
	--color-secondary-light: #00C853;
	--color-accent-hover: #E55A28;
	--gradient-primary: linear-gradient(135deg, #00A651 0%, #00C853 100%);
	--gradient-hero: linear-gradient(135deg, rgba(11,29,51,0.92) 0%, rgba(19,45,74,0.85) 100%);
	--gradient-cta: linear-gradient(135deg, #FF6B35 0%, #FF8F5E 100%);
	--gradient-dark: linear-gradient(180deg, #0A1F2E 0%, #0D2B3E 100%);
	--radius-sm: 6px;
	--radius-md: 10px;
	--radius-lg: 16px;
	--radius-pill: 50px;
	--shadow-sm: 0 1px 3px rgba(0,0,0,0.06), 0 1px 2px rgba(0,0,0,0.04);
	--shadow-md: 0 4px 6px rgba(0,0,0,0.04), 0 2px 4px rgba(0,0,0,0.06);
	--shadow-lg: 0 10px 25px rgba(0,0,0,0.08), 0 4px 10px rgba(0,0,0,0.04);
	--shadow-xl: 0 20px 50px rgba(0,0,0,0.12), 0 8px 20px rgba(0,0,0,0.06);
	--ease-out-expo: cubic-bezier(0.16, 1, 0.3, 1);
	--ease-out-quart: cubic-bezier(0.25, 1, 0.5, 1);
}
